AJ Pritchard: Strictly star almost REPEATS mortifying blunder with Lauren Steadman

The 23-year-old dancer previously dropped his partner, 25, just moments after learning who he was paired with on the launch show earlier this year. AJ, who joined the Strictly Come Dancing professional line-up in 2016, whirled the Paralympian around after he was announced as her partner, but was left red-faced when he nearly caused her to land in a heap on the floor. On Saturday night, the pair were astounded to be saved from the dance off by the public vote after finishing bottom of the leaderboard.

When Lauren and AJ appeared on It Takes Two tonight, host Zoe Ball, 47, told them: “The public most definitely had your back.”

Clearly still in shock at the incredible support they received from the viewers, Lauren said: “The fact that people at home are really enjoying our dancing and the journey — I’m so grateful.

“Words can’t describe enough how much we were overwhelmed by the support of the people at home,” AJ chipped in, admitting: “We were ready to dance again.”

“He nearly dropped me down the stairs,” Lauren laughed.

“I screamed, I picked you up, I threw you around,” AJ recalled. “I forgot we were standing on the stairs.

“It was nearly a disaster,” he told Zoe, adding: “But the support is overwhelming.”

Despite having nearly repeated his launch show blunder by coming dangerously close to dropping his partner again, AJ was as delighted as the World Champion to have made it through to next week’s quarter finals.

The good news came after they found themselves at sea at the bottom of the leaderboard, scoring a disappointing 23 points for their Salsa, 16 marks less than Faye Tozer’s triumphant Waltz.

It was a double blow for Lauren and AJ when they also failed to impress the judges in the Lindy-Hop-a-thon.

The competition, which saw all seven remaining couples take to the dance floor at the same time to battle for additional points, may have descended into chaos when it came to reading out the scores, but the pair nonetheless received the lowest bonus mark of just one.

In contrast, Ashley Roberts, 37, and her partner Pasha Kovalev, 38, scooped seven extra points, while Faye and Giovanni Pernice, 28, held on to their lead with six more on top of their 39 for their Waltz.

Strictly stars Lauren and AJ will be hoping to put last week’s struggles behind them for Musicals Week next weekend as they take on a brand new dance style: the American Smooth.

On It Takes Two, they revealed they will be performing to the soundtrack of I’m In Love With A Wonderful Guy from South Pacific.

“We get the bonus of adding in lifts and being out of hold a little bit more,” AJ teased. “We are excited.

“It’s going to be something special,” he promised fans.

Tackling the American Smooth Viennese Waltz this weekend, the duo have high hopes after previously achieving their best score for their Viennese Waltz earlier in the series.
